Chrome Dino Run
A 8-bit game comes for the people who love old-school styled graphics, with a dinosaur at an infinite desert. Your goal is to avoid cacti. Each time you jump over a cactus, you get one point. Claim that you are the best at this game and show your skills to your friends by doing the highest score! Let the Chrome Dino run begin!
Rules and Tips for Chrome Dino Run
Use "LEFT-CLICK" to jump.
Key Game Features
There are six different dino characters inside of this game. You can unlock these characters if you can reach enough points. Check dino select screen for more details.
